Overview of FY 11-12 Funded Projects
-
by
Matthew Cimitile
—
published
Feb 22, 2013
—
last modified
Aug 28, 2013 10:56 AM
—
filed under:
Climate Change,
Energy,
Projects
Describes the six projects currently funded by the Appalachian LCC through 2012. These include a Stream Classification System, Development of Hydrologic Foundation, Assessing Future Impacts of Energy Extraction, Understanding Land Use and Climate Change, Riparian Restoration Tool to Promote Climate Change Resilience, and Data Needs Assessment to Support Conservation Planning.
